The New Mexico State Aggies (1-3) will attempt to defy oddsmakers when they square off against the Hawaii Rainbow Warriors (1-3) on Saturday, September 25, 2021 as a massive 17-point underdog. The over/under is 58.5 for this matchup.

Over/Under Insights

  • Hawaii and its opponents have combined for 58.5 points -- this matchup's point total -- just one time this season.
  • New Mexico State's games have gone over 58.5 points in two opportunities this season.
  • Saturday's total is 13.4 points higher than the combined 45.1 PPG average of the two teams.
  • The 67.1 points per game these two squads have allowed to opponents this season are 8.6 more than the 58.5 total in this contest.
  • The Rainbow Warriors and their opponents have scored an average of 65.3 points per game in 2021, 6.8 more than Saturday's total.
  • In 2021, games involving the Aggies have averaged a total of 54.1 points, 4.4 fewer than this game's set over/under.

Hawaii Stats and Trends

  • Hawaii has covered the spread on one occasion this season.
  • Hawaii's games this year have gone over the total in one out of three opportunities (33.3%).
  • This year, the Rainbow Warriors put up 7.0 fewer points per game (24.8) than the Aggies give up (31.8).
  • The Rainbow Warriors collect 416.3 yards per game, 34.2 fewer yards than the 450.5 the Aggies allow per outing.
  • Hawaii is 0-1 against the spread and 1-1 overall when the team piles up more than 450.5 yards.
  • The Rainbow Warriors have turned the ball over nine times this season, one more turnover than the Aggies have forced (8).

New Mexico State Stats and Trends

  • In New Mexico State's four games this year, it has three wins against the spread.
  • This season, the Aggies have won ATS in each of their two games as an underdog of 17 points or more.
  • New Mexico State's games this season have gone over the total in two out of four opportunities (50%).
  • The Aggies rack up 20.3 points per game, 15.0 fewer than the Rainbow Warriors surrender (35.3).
  • The Aggies average 95.5 fewer yards per game (334.0) than the Rainbow Warriors allow per outing (429.5).
  • The Aggies have six giveaways this season, while the Rainbow Warriors have seven takeaways .
